Associate Admissions Director jobs in Ohio

Associate Admissions Director oversees one or multiple areas of student admissions. Manages and implements strategic recruitment and communication plans to ensure college's enrollment goals. Being an Associate Admissions Director may take part in graduate school admissions and scholarship administrations. Requires a bachelor's degree. Additionally, Associate Admissions Director typically reports to Chief Admissions Officer. The Associate Admissions Director man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. Extensive knowledge of department processes. To be an Associate Admissions Director typ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 to 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Associate Director of Graduate Admissions
  • Capital University
  • Columbus, OH FULL_TIME
  • Capital University is seeking an Associate Director of Graduate Admissions to recruit and enroll qualified and diverse students in its current and future graduate and post-baccalaureate programs, as well as certificate and continuing education programs. The Associate Director will report to the Director of Graduate Admissions and will assist in processing applications and advising incoming students in conjunction with deans, program directors, and faculty. They will develop, maintain, and execute innovative tactics to proactively engage and yield prospective students to meet targeted enrollment goals. They will plan, implement, and attend external and on-campus recruitment events, and generate effective communication strategies, including use of the customer relationship management system (Slate), social media, workshops and presentations. The Associate Director will engage with external organizations for the purpose of generating enrollment in graduate and post-baccalaureate business programs. The position requires occasional travel, as well as evening and weekend responsibilities.


    Responsibilities:

    • Manage inquiries and applications for across all Adult and Graduate programs. Process applications and advise incoming students in conjunction with program directors and the Graduate Admissions team.
    • Develop and implement recruitment strategies to meet targeted enrollment goals. Proactively identify and yield qualified, diverse students for Capital University's portfolio of Adult and Graduate programs.
    • Travel to organizations, graduate and career fairs, and other events to promote Capital programs.
    • Create and deliver effective info sessions, on campus events, and other presentations.
    • Utilize the CRM (Slate) by developing reports and queries that increases efficiency in processing leads and applications in a timely manner.
    • Track and assess the effectiveness of recruitment and admissions activities, and recommend and implement improvements to meet enrollment goals.
    • Assist in developing strategic and impactful communication flows, and other marketing initiatives.
    • Assist with the training and general onboarding of new staff.
    • Work effectively with campus partners to meet mutual objectives, including deans, program directors, student development directors, marketing, financial aid, registrar, and admissions operations. Serve on appropriate University committees and task forces as needed.
    • Actively participate in onboarding activities for new Adult and Graduate students, including new student orientation.
    • Collaborate with the Director of Graduate Admissions, program directors, and other stakeholders to identify and engage with external organizations for the purpose of generating enrollment in assigned programs.

    Qualifications:

    • Bachelor's degree from a four-year college or university required; Master's degree preferred.
    • Three years of experience in admissions recruitment for Adult or Graduate higher education programs preferred.
    • Professional written and oral communication skills. Ability to effectively present information to a wide range of constituents, including senior organizational leaders, public groups, and people from diverse cultures and worldviews.
    • Ability to work professionally with others as part of a team, be adaptable, and work well with diverse constituents.
    • Demonstrated success taking initiative, collaboratively setting and attaining performance goals, working without close supervision, and managing multiple priorities under deadlines.
    • Ability to define problems and make data-informed decisions to improve outcomes.
    • Excellent skills in Microsoft Word, Outlook, Microsoft Excel, Power Point. Proficient in using CRM and ERP technology. Slate and Ellucian Colleague experience preferred.
